There is a "ski resort" similar to the one in Alabama shown here.
it is not located in the Alps or the Pyrenees, usual areas for ski resorts, but just 40 km southwest of the capital Paris.
When the weather permits, the town hall of the small town of Janvry takes out the snow cannons and opens the temporary ski resort of “Janvoriaz”
